Discover How Transportation Revolution Transformed American Manufacturing
You will learn how the Transportation Revolution of the 1800s changed manufacturing by connecting factories to distant markets through canals, railroads, and steamboats.
Introduction
You will discover how the Transportation Revolution of the 1800s completely changed American manufacturing. Before this revolution, most goods were made by hand in small workshops. After new transportation systems like canals and roads and railroad expansion were built, factories could ship products to customers hundreds of miles away.
How Transportation Changed Manufacturing
You will learn that improved transportation allowed factories to grow much larger than before. When canals connected inland areas to major waterways, raw materials like cotton and iron could reach factories more easily. Factory owners built their mills near these transportation routes to reduce shipping costs and take advantage of faster delivery times.
Steamboats revolutionized river transportation by allowing two-way travel. Unlike flatboats that could only go downstream, steamboats could travel upstream against the current. This made it possible for manufacturers to receive materials and ship finished products more efficiently along rivers.
Steam Power and Factory Growth
You will understand how steam engines transformed where factories could be built. Before steam power, factories needed water wheels near rivers for energy. Steam engines freed factory owners to build anywhere, not just beside flowing water. This flexibility helped manufacturing centers develop in new locations across the countryside.
The introduction of power looms in textile mills allowed fabric production to become much faster than traditional handweaving. These mechanized looms could produce cloth at speeds impossible with hand methods, helping textile manufacturing grow rapidly during this period.
Transportation Networks and Factory Towns
You will see how manufacturing towns grew around key transportation hubs where multiple routes intersected. Workers moved to these areas seeking employment in textile mills and iron works. As transportation networks expanded, these factory towns could ship their products to markets across the nation.
Turnpikes, which were improved toll roads, allowed horse-drawn wagons to transport goods even in bad weather. This reliability helped factory owners maintain consistent delivery schedules and coordinate with suppliers across greater distances.
Key Terms & Definitions
Transportation Revolution: The period in the 1800s when new transportation systems like canals, railroads, and steamboats transformed how people and goods moved across America.
Manufacturing: The process of making goods in factories using machines and workers, rather than making items by hand in homes or small workshops.
Canals: Human-made waterways that connected rivers, lakes, and other bodies of water to allow boats to travel between different areas.
Steamboats: Boats powered by steam engines that could travel upstream against river currents, making two-way river transportation possible.
Railroads: Transportation systems using trains that run on metal tracks, connecting cities and towns across long distances.
Textile Mills: Large factories where cloth and fabric were produced using power looms and other machinery.
Raw Materials: Basic materials like cotton, iron, and minerals that factories use to make finished products.
Finished Products: Completed goods that factories make from raw materials and sell to customers.
Steam Power: Energy created by steam engines that could power factory machines without needing to be located near rivers.
Power Looms: Mechanized machines that could weave fabric much faster than traditional handweaving methods.
Turnpikes: Improved roads where travelers paid tolls to use better-maintained surfaces that allowed reliable transportation in various weather conditions.
Factory Towns: Communities that developed around manufacturing centers where workers lived and worked in industrial facilities.
